PLAY
There are many benefits to gain from playing games and making puzzles. Both are great for your mental health, assisting in relieving stress, improving mood, increasing self confidence and helping prolong cognitive decline as you age. Think of puzzles and games as a workout for your brain...and they're just plain fun, too.
